Shifting visitor behaviour reshapes the tourism landscape

The OECD Tourism Trends and Policies 2026 report explores challenges and opportunities for the sector. As geopolitical tensions, shifting traveller behaviour and extreme weather-related events continue to shape the tourism landscape, OECD said destinations will need to strengthen their ability to anticipate and adapt.

The OECD Tourism Trends and Policies 2026 report shows the conflict in the Middle East has disrupted global travel flows and increased costs, which is weighing on traveller confidence. See Destination NSW’s key take away points here or delve into the full report
